CHAPTER VIII FAMILY ERYCINIDiE SUB-FAMILY Libytheins Genus: I. LIBYTHEA CARINENTA (Cram). I have taken this butterfly not uncommonly in the Cayo District in company with Catopsilias and Papilios congregated together on wet sand. Its flight is very swift. SUB-FAMILY Eryeininm 2. MESOSEMIA TELEGONE (Bois). A pretty little butterfly which is usually found resting on the leaves of bushes with wings spread out. I have taken specimens of it in the west and also in the Corozal District. 3. MESOSEMIA METHION (Hew). I have only taken this insect at San Pedro Sarstoon. 4. LEPRICORNIS STRIGOSUS (Stgr). Seldom taken, and only in the neighbourhood of San Pedro Sarstoon.
